Qin Zou is a scholar working on Molecular Biology, Neurology and Cancer Research. According to data from OpenAlex, Qin Zou has authored 25 papers receiving a total of 818 indexed citations (citations by other indexed papers that have themselves been cited), including 16 papers in Molecular Biology, 5 papers in Neurology and 4 papers in Cancer Research. Recurrent topics in Qin Zou’s work include RNA modifications and cancer (8 papers), RNA Research and Splicing (5 papers) and RNA and protein synthesis mechanisms (4 papers). Qin Zou is often cited by papers focused on RNA modifications and cancer (8 papers), RNA Research and Splicing (5 papers) and RNA and protein synthesis mechanisms (4 papers). Qin Zou collaborates with scholars based in China and United States. Qin Zou's co-authors include Xuerui Yang, Zhengtao Xiao, Yu Liu, Jianhuo Fang, Youcheng Zhang, Chuan He, Phillip J. Hsu, Yuchuan Zhou, Zhen Lin and Guifang Jia and has published in prestigious journals such as Nature Communications, The EMBO Journal and Genome biology.
